对象存储是怎么存的啊,深入解析对象存储,揭秘数据如何存储在云端
- 综合资讯
- 2024-11-14 01:32:23
- 2

对象存储通过将数据分为对象,每个对象包含数据、元数据和唯一标识符进行存储。数据存储在云端,利用分布式存储架构保证高可用性和扩展性。通过HTTP协议进行数据访问,简化操作...
对象存储通过将数据分为对象,每个对象包含数据、元数据和唯一标识符进行存储。数据存储在云端,利用分布式存储架构保证高可用性和扩展性。通过HTTP协议进行数据访问,简化操作流程。深入了解对象存储,揭示其存储机制和云端数据管理奥秘。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足企业对数据存储的需求,为了解决这一问题,对象存储应运而生,本文将深入解析对象存储的存储原理、技术特点以及应用场景,帮助读者全面了解这一新兴存储技术。
对象存储概述
1、定义
对象存储(Object Storage)是一种基于对象的存储技术,将数据存储为一个个独立的对象,每个对象由元数据、数据和唯一标识符(如对象键)组成,对象存储通常采用分布式架构,将数据分散存储在多个物理节点上,提高数据的安全性和可靠性。
2、优势
(1)高扩展性:对象存储支持横向扩展,可根据需求增加存储节点,提高存储容量。
(2)低成本:对象存储采用通用硬件,降低存储成本。
(3)高性能:分布式架构提高了数据访问速度,满足大规模数据存储需求。
(4)高可靠性:数据冗余存储,确保数据安全。
(5)易于使用:提供丰富的API接口,方便用户进行数据操作。
对象存储存储原理
1、数据存储
(1)元数据:包括对象键、对象类型、创建时间、最后修改时间、访问权限等。
(2)数据:用户上传的数据内容。
(3)唯一标识符:对象键,用于唯一标识一个对象。
2、存储结构
对象存储采用树状结构,将所有对象存储在一个名为bucket的容器中,bucket类似于文件夹,用于组织和管理对象。
3、分布式存储
对象存储采用分布式架构,将数据分散存储在多个物理节点上,当用户访问数据时,系统根据数据所在的物理节点,将请求转发到相应的节点进行数据读取。
4、数据冗余
为了提高数据可靠性,对象存储采用数据冗余技术,常见的数据冗余方式有:
(1)多副本:将数据复制多个副本,存储在不同物理节点上。
(2)纠删码:将数据分割成多个片段,分散存储在不同物理节点上,通过校验码恢复数据。
对象存储技术特点
1、高度可扩展性
对象存储采用分布式架构,可根据需求增加存储节点,实现无限扩展。
2、低成本
对象存储采用通用硬件,降低存储成本。
3、高性能
分布式架构提高了数据访问速度,满足大规模数据存储需求。
4、高可靠性
数据冗余存储,确保数据安全。
5、易于使用
提供丰富的API接口,方便用户进行数据操作。
对象存储应用场景
1、大数据存储
对象存储适用于大规模数据存储,如日志、视频、图片等。
2、云计算
对象存储可作为云计算平台的基础设施,提供数据存储服务。
分发网络(CDN)
对象存储可用于CDN加速,提高用户访问速度。
4、数据备份与归档
对象存储可满足企业数据备份与归档需求,降低数据丢失风险。
对象存储作为一种新兴的存储技术,具有高扩展性、低成本、高性能、高可靠性等优点,随着互联网技术的不断发展,对象存储将在各个领域得到广泛应用,本文深入解析了对象存储的存储原理、技术特点以及应用场景,希望对读者有所帮助。
本文链接:https://www.zhitaoyun.cn/810727.html
发表评论